Auburn Golf Course

Played On 08/25/2021
I Recommend This Course
4.0
Previously Played

Great but slow

The course allows fivesomes and does not use marshals. 5 hour rounds are the norm every day. The back nine is great. The front nine is average. It’s very well maintained.

Druids Glen

Played On 08/02/2018
2.0
Verified Purchaser
Previously Played
Perfect weather
Used cart

Course in Rehab

Course has still not recovered from a really bad summer two years ago. Most of the fairways are very thin. Greens range from good (#18) to sad. This is the reason why its cheap and easy to book.

The course has a interesting layout, but you really need a golf cart. Its not a walking friendly. It played really slow for a midweek twilight round. They did have a beverage cart!

Enumclaw Golf Course

Played On 08/20/2017
I Recommend This Course
3.0
Verified Purchaser
Previously Played
Perfect weather
Used cart

Cow pasture with challenging greens

The course is short but throws in a lot of elevation changes to make things interesting. Both tee boxes and greens are elevated. Small creeks are used to protect the greens. The greens are generally fast and have a lot of undulations. The fairway conditions run from mediocre to terrible. We (2some) teed off early on Sunday morning and finished in less than 4 hours.
